This list of major arts events scheduled for New Jersey will be constantly updated throughout the year, as new events are announced.
May 16-18: The Exit Zero Jazz Festival takes place in Cape May. With Samara Joy, Terence Blanchard, Lisa Fischer and others.
May 22, 24-25 and 28-29: Beyoncé will bring her Cowboy Carter Tour to MetLife Stadium in East Rutherford.
May 30-31 and June 1: Crawfish Fest at Sussex County Fairgrounds, Augusta. With Marcia Ball, Terrance Simien & the Zydeco Experience, Southern Avenue, Bonerama, Rockin’ Dopsie & the Zydeco Twisters, Corey Harris, Carolyn Wonderland, others.
June 9-29: This year’s edition of the annual North to Shore Festival will feature events in Newark, Asbury Park and Atlantic City.
June 19-22: Barefoot Country Music Fest, Wildwood. With Jason Aldean, Jelly Roll, Rascal Flatts, Lainey Wilson, Boyz II Men, Jordan Davis, Megan Moroney, Colt Ford, others.
June 20: As part of the North to Shore Festival, The Prudential Center in Newark will host Hot 97’s annual Summer Jam concert with with A Boogie, Gunna, GloRilla, Muni Long, Asake, Ayra Starr, Ja Rule and others.
June 27-29: Rock, Ribs and Ridges Festival at Sussex County Fairgrounds, Augusta. With The Allman Betts Band, Grand Funk Railroad, Atlanta Rhythm Section, Black Stone Cherry, The Weight Band, The Artimus Pyle Band, Orleans, others.
Aug. 9: My Chemical Romance will perform its 2006 album The Black Parade in its entirety, and more, at MetLife Stadium in East Rutherford, with Death Cab for Cutie and Thursday opening.
Aug. 16: Morristown Jazz and Blues Festival. Lineup TBA.
Aug. 29-31: Delaware Valley Bluegrass Festival at Salem County Fair Grounds, Woodstown. With The Del McCoury Band, Ricky Skaggs & Kentucky Thunder, Authentic Unlimited, Danny Paisley & the Southern Grass, John Jorgensen Bluegrass Band, Rhonda Vincent & the Rage, Don Flemons, more.
Aug. 31 and Sept. 1: Oasis‘ reunion tour will come to MetLife Stadium in East Rutherford, with Cage the Elephant opening.
Sept. 12: Outlaw Music Festival with Willie Nelson & Family, Bob Dylan, Sheryl Crow, Waxahatchee, Madeline Edwards at Freedom Mortgage Pavilion, Camden.
Sept. 13: Outlaw Music Festival with Willie Nelson & Family, Bob Dylan, Sheryl Crow, Waxahatchee, Madeline Edwards, at PNC Bank Arts Center, Holmdel.
Sept. 13: Montclair Jazz Festival. Lineup TBA.
Sept. 13-14: Sea.Hear.Now festival, Asbury Park, withy Blink-182, Hozier, Lenny Kravitz, LCD Soundsystem, Alabama Shakes, Sublime, Public Enemy, De La Soul, ZZ Top, Trombone Shorty & Orleans Avenue, TV on the Radio, Spoon, UB40, 4 Non Blondes, others.
Sept. 19-21: XPoNential Music Festival at Wiggins Park, Camden. Sharon Van Etten & the Attachment Theory, Courtney Barnett, Molly Tuttle, Richard Thompson, Greensky Bluegrass, Craig Finn, Spin Doctors, War, Preservation Hall Jazz Band, Tune-Yards, Kathleen Edwards, Southern Avenue and more.
